What Is a DMX512 Underwater Light?

A DMX512 Underwater Light is a waterproof LED lighting fixture that can be connected to a DMX512 lighting control system.

Unlike standard single-color underwater lights, DMX512-controlled fixtures allow users to control lighting effects through a centralized controller.

Depending on the project design, the system can be programmed for:

  • Static colors

  • RGB color mixing

  • RGBW color mixing

  • Smooth color transitions

  • Color gradients

  • Dynamic lighting scenes

  • Sequential lighting effects

  • Synchronized fountain lighting

  • Timed lighting programs

This makes DMX512 underwater lighting particularly suitable for large-scale landscape and architectural projects where multiple fixtures need to work together.

For example, a hotel fountain can use dozens or hundreds of underwater lights connected to one DMX512 control system. The lighting designer can program different scenes for normal operation, weekends, festivals, special events, or music performances.

DMX512 RGB and RGBW Color Control

One of the main advantages of DMX512 underwater lighting is flexible color control.

RGB LED technology combines red, green, and blue light sources to create a wide range of colors.

RGBW technology adds a dedicated white LED channel, allowing designers to achieve both colorful effects and more natural white illumination.

Depending on the project requirements, DMX512 underwater lights can be used for:

  • Blue water effects

  • Green landscape effects

  • Purple and pink decorative lighting

  • Warm white illumination

  • Cool white illumination

  • RGB color changing

  • RGBW dynamic lighting

  • Gradient color transitions

This flexibility allows architects, lighting designers, and landscape contractors to create different visual effects without changing the physical lighting fixtures.


DC24V Low Voltage Solution

DC24V is a practical option for many outdoor underwater lighting applications.

A low-voltage lighting system can simplify the design of certain water feature projects and provide an additional safety consideration around water environments.

A typical system may include:

AC power supply → DC24V power supply → DMX512 controller → underwater LED lights

The exact electrical configuration should be designed according to the project requirements and local electrical regulations.

How to Choose the Right DMX512 Underwater Light?

Before selecting an underwater lighting fixture, project contractors and lighting designers should consider several factors.

1. Waterproof Rating

For underwater applications, IP68 protection is commonly required. The actual product should be selected according to the installation environment and water depth.

2. Lighting Color

Choose between:

  • Single color

  • RGB

  • RGBW

  • Tunable white

RGB is suitable for colorful decorative effects, while RGBW provides additional white-light flexibility.

3. Control System

For dynamic lighting projects, confirm compatibility between the underwater lights, DMX512 controller, power supply, wiring, and other lighting fixtures.

4. Voltage

DC24V can be considered for low-voltage outdoor water feature applications where appropriate.

5. Beam Angle

Beam angle affects how light is distributed through the water.

Narrow beam angles can create focused lighting effects, while wider beam angles can provide broader illumination.

6. Installation Method

The fixture should be selected according to the installation location and mounting requirements.

Different projects may require different mounting accessories, cable lengths, power ratings, and housing materials.

FAQ About DMX512 Underwater Light

What is a DMX512 Underwater Light?

A DMX512 underwater light is a waterproof LED fixture that can communicate with a DMX512 lighting control system to achieve programmable color and lighting effects.

 Can DMX512 underwater lights change colors?

Yes. When configured with RGB or RGBW LEDs, DMX512 underwater lights can produce different colors, color-changing effects, gradients, and programmable lighting scenes.

Are DMX512 underwater lights suitable for fountains?

Yes. They are particularly suitable for fountain projects because multiple fixtures can be controlled together to create synchronized lighting effects.

Can DMX512 underwater lights use DC24V?

Yes. DC24V configurations are available for suitable low-voltage underwater lighting applications. The power supply and electrical system should be designed according to the project requirements and local regulations.

What waterproof rating should an underwater LED light have?

IP68 is commonly selected for professional underwater lighting applications. However, the required protection level should be confirmed according to the installation environment, water depth, and project requirements.

What is the difference between RGB and RGBW underwater lights?

RGB uses red, green, and blue LEDs to create different colors. RGBW adds a dedicated white LED channel, providing better white-light output and additional color-mixing flexibility.

Can DMX512 underwater lights be synchronized with other lights?

Yes. When compatible DMX512 products and control equipment are used, underwater lights can be integrated into a larger DMX512 lighting system.

Where can I use DMX512 underwater lights?

They can be used in fountains, swimming pools, hotels, resorts, landscape ponds, water features, waterfront projects, commercial plazas, and architectural landscape projects.
